![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
||
|
使用“检查浏览器”动作可根据访问者不同类型和版本的浏览器将他们转到不同的页。例如,您可能想要使用 Navigator 4.0 或更高版本浏览器的访问者转到一页,让使用 Internet Explorer 4.0 或更高版本的访问者转到另一页,并让使用任何其他类型浏览器的访问者留在当前页上。
将此行为附加到几乎与任何浏览器都兼容的页(该页不使用任何其他 JavaScript)的 body
标签将十分有用;这样,已关闭 JavaScript 功能的访问者在访问此页时仍可以看到内容。
另一个办法是将此行为附加到一个空链接(例如 <a href="javascript:;">
)并让该动作根据访问者浏览器的类型和版本确定链接的目标。
例如,是否要让所有具有 4.0 版浏览器的访问者看到一页,而让所有其他人看到另外一页?或者让 Netscape Navigator 用户看到一页而让 Internet Explorer 用户看到另外一页。
选项包括“转到 URL”、“转到替代 URL”和“留在此页”。
选项包括“转到 URL”、“转到替代 URL”和“留在此页”。
“留在此页”是用于 Navigator 和 IE 之外浏览器的最佳选项,因为它们大多数不支持 JavaScript - 如果它们不能读取此行为,它们无论如何都会留在此页上。
如果不是,则从弹出式菜单中选择另一个事件。如果未列出所需的事件,则在“显示事件”弹出式菜单中更改目标浏览器。请记住此行为的目的是检查是否存在不同的浏览器版本,因此最好选择一个在 3.0 和更高版本的浏览器上都起作用的事件。
|
||
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|